Discover Walmart's Fall Home Drop: Unmissable Items for Your Home

Cozy living room with fall decor in soft tones.

Unveiling the Essence of Walmart’s Fall Home Drop

The arrival of fall brings with it a unique opportunity to refresh your living space, and Walmart’s latest home drop is poised to inspire both homeowners and contractors alike. The collection, curated to blend practicality with aesthetic appeal, offers a range of items that accommodate various styles and preferences, ensuring that everyone can find something to elevate their home ambiance.

Why This Collection Stands Out

This season's fall home drop at Walmart is particularly noteworthy for its strength in versatility and affordability. It includes everything from decorative pillows and throws to essential kitchenware that emphasizes comfort and warmth. These selections embody the essence of fall, making it easy for consumers to create inviting spaces without breaking the bank.

Social Connection: The Importance of Seasonal Decor

Investing in seasonal decor is about more than just aesthetics—it's about fostering social connections. As the weather cools and gatherings with family and friends become more frequent, creating a cozy environment enhances the experience. Whether it’s a rich pumpkin-scented candle or a tablecloth adorned with autumn leaves, the right decor creates mood and sparks joy among guests.

What’s Hot: Items You Can’t Miss

Among the standout products, Walmart features editor-approved items that promise to make a significant impact in any home. For instance, their selection of patterned throw pillows adds a pop of color, while soft blankets are perfect for chilly evenings. Additionally, unique wall art can transform a plain room into a stylish retreat.

Practical Insights: Making the Most of Your Decor

As contractors and DIY enthusiasts explore these offerings, it's essential to consider practical insights. Incorporating seasonal decor doesn’t have to be a daunting task. Simple changes, like swapping out summer-themed items for fall ones or adding a few well-placed accents, can make a big difference. Moreover, making these adjustments throughout the year can keep your design fresh and appealing.

Seeking Balance and Value: How to Shop Smart

As we embrace this beautiful fall collection, it's crucial to focus on balance and value when shopping. Opt for high-impact items that provide versatility—think of multi-use decorative pieces or essentials that can be transitioned to other seasons. This mindful approach to purchasing not only enhances your home but also supports sustainability.

Discover the Beautiful Country Kitchens of Amanda Pays and Corbin Bernsen

Update Transformative Country Kitchens: The Artistry of Amanda Pays and Corbin Bernsen Amanda Pays and Corbin Bernsen have established themselves as a remarkable duo in the realm of home renovation, particularly known for their heartfelt transformation of country kitchens. With decades of experience managing more than 30 renovation projects together, this couple brings both passion and expertise to their craft. Their approach to remodeling not only embraces practical design but also infuses each space with a narrative—communicating warmth and the spirit of home. Natural Materials and Eco-Friendly Choices Central to their design philosophy is a commitment to environmental sustainability. Amanda and Corbin were early proponents of the “restore, recycle, reuse” approach, often sourcing materials that celebrate history while serving a functional purpose. For example, in their Los Angeles kitchen, they used old barn wood for cabinetry alongside vintage pulls dramatically acquired at a swap meet. This innovative use of materials embodies their belief that a kitchen should be both beautiful and practical. Creating Flow in Spaces: The Importance of Open Design Both Amanda and Corbin emphasize the significance of space fluidity in their designs. They often envision rooms that flow into one another, creating an inviting atmosphere meant for cooking and gathering. For instance, their renovation in Hudson Valley showcased an open-plan kitchen that seamlessly integrated with the dining area and a cozy media room. This integration fosters not only aesthetics but also enriches family life, as loved ones gather not just for meals but for shared experiences. A Global Perspective on Design The couple's fascination with different cultures is reflected in their projects. Their home in the South of France features a kitchen that melds rustic French style with contemporary functionality, illustrating their ability to blend traditional and modern influences. The use of Plaster-finished surfaces and unique fixtures creates a serene environment where the culinary arts can flourish, a critical element in their country design philosophy. Practical Insights: Tips from the Remodeling Experts Amanda and Corbin have generously shared their knowledge with aspiring remodelers. Their advice often highlights practical strategies for saving money while achieving quality results. For instance, Amanda often advises sourcing materials second-hand or finding unique gems at flea markets to craft one-of-a-kind pieces that narrate your home's story. Armed with this advice, homeowners can innovate their own personal spaces in a cost-effective manner. Conclusion: Making Maplewood Memories and Where to Start As Amanda Pays and Corbin Bernsen continue their journey in home renovation, they redefine how homeowners perceive their space. Their country kitchens serve as a beacon of inspiration, encouraging others to embrace eco-friendly practices while prioritizing design and functionality. For those looking to dive into an affordable yet elegant kitchen remodel, begin by listing priorities, researching local markets for unique finds, and considering elements that enhance the flow of your home. Dive Into the Best West Elm Collab Yet: Pierce & Ward Collection

Update West Elm's Latest Collaboration: A Game Changer for Home Design Home décor trends constantly evolve, but each new collaboration brings its unique flair that can redefine the landscape of interior design. The recent partnership between Pierce & Ward and West Elm stands out as a bright spark in this crowded arena. With a carefully curated assortment of over 100 products, this collaboration offers exceptional quality at prices that are notably accessible, catering to design enthusiasts and casual decorators alike. Introducing Pierce & Ward: A Dynamic Design Duo Co-founders Louisa Pierce and Emily Ward have made a name for themselves with their vibrant, layered aesthetic that combines vintage elements with modern sensibilities. This collaboration seeks to encapsulate that aesthetic, offering pieces steeped in artistry while remaining functional. Shopping at their Los Angeles boutique or browsing their Instagram reveals a treasure trove of inspiration marked by bold colors, intricate patterns, and charming antique finds. Unlocking Vintage Charm at Affordable Prices What makes this collection particularly compelling is the opportunity to obtain pieces that feel high-end without the exorbitant price tags typically associated with vintage items. West Elm's partnership aims to democratize access to luxurious home goods, with items starting as low as $29. From stunning ceramics to striking rugs, the collection’s price points make it possible for homeowners to infuse high-style aesthetics into their living spaces without breaking the bank. A Closer Look at the Collection The Pierce & Ward collection features an enticing mix of furniture, textiles, lighting, and home accessories designed to add character to any room. Noteworthy items include: Counter Stool: Stylish with curved iron legs and juniper velvet upholstery, perfect for kitchen islands. Curved Slipper Chair: Featuring moody stripes, this chair is ideal for cozy corners or as accent seating. Handwoven Rugs: Offering an Art Deco aesthetic, these pieces lend a touch of sophistication to any floor. Each element showcases the duo's trademark bold colors such as deep greens, blush shades, and ivories, making it easy to create a harmonious and inviting interior. Discover Casa Capirote: A Kaleidoscope of Seville’s Craft and Color

Update A Colorful Tribute to Andalusian Heritage In the heart of Seville, the vibrant new Casa Capirote emerges as a modern ode to the region's rich cultural tapestry. Designed by the Andalusian studio Cateto Cateto, this compact apartment transforms traditional elements of local craftsmanship into a strikingly contemporary living space. The design draws inspiration from Seville’s renowned Triana pottery—a symbol of craftsmanship characterized by its bold colors and intricate patterns. Crafting Emotion Through Design The apartment's interior speaks a language of colors—deep cobalt blues interwoven with refreshing greens and rosy coral hues. Every detail tells a story; from the cobalt blue kitchen chairs to a tiled bathroom that reflects the artistry of historic ceramics. Together, these colors create a tapestry that balances modern aesthetics with welcoming warmth. Fluidity in Function: A Space That Breathes Breaking the mold of traditional room layouts, Casa Capirote employs curtains instead of walls, allowing inhabitants the flexibility to create intimate or open spaces as desired. This adaptable approach mirrors Seville's dynamic lifestyle—effortlessly shifting from lively social gatherings to serene, private moments. The Importance of Textures and Materials Textures play a significant role in an environment that’s both inviting and rooted in history. The use of earthy lime mortar recalls ancient building techniques while offering a sensory experience that feels fully connected to Andalusian architecture. Additionally, handcrafted details, like the artistically painted headboard and graphic floor tiles, contribute a layer of authenticity to the overall design. The Great Outdoors: Expanding Living Spaces Casan Capirote extends its charm beyond the confines of its interior into an outdoor terrace enriched with tropical greenery. This space is equipped with a peaceful water feature and seating areas, offering the perfect retreat to enjoy the balmy climate of Seville. The terrace connects the indoors and outdoors harmoniously, enhancing the overall atmosphere of the apartment. Symbolic Colors: What Do They Mean? Each color selection has deeper meanings rooted in culture and emotions. For example, the calming greens symbolize renewal and peace, while the vibrant coral ignites feelings of joy and creativity. The strategic use of these tones not only reflects the natural surroundings but also promotes a positive mental environment for its inhabitants. Celebrating Craftsmanship Through Modern Design At its core, Casa Capirote is a celebration of Andalusian craftsmanship reinterpreted through a modern lens. This thoughtfully designed apartment signifies how traditional artistry can marry contemporary design, creating spaces that not only serve their function but also tell a historical narrative.
